Even if the guy is legit and knows his stuff he is going to win 55% of his plays longterm. So your buddy needs to figure out if it is worth it too pay for someone's picks if they hit 55%. Bottom line you need to bet big and win (not at all what I am advising) if you are going to pay for plays. There is no secret to this. The best win at about that rate.

This game is extremely hard to beat, there are no shortcuts. Be careful and look at this logically,figure out if you will make money with the numbers I laid out to you. More times then now I doubt it. Tell your friend to get away quickly. He should be thankful he didnt get buried . Not many people win money in the scenairo you described.

i have always said why would a guy who can make money on his own sell picks think about it.do i want a bunch of strangers who are probably well known deadbeats all there lives on the same side as me jinxing my plays.

touts are full of shit if you could do it on your own you wouldnt need to sell picks.

i am a tout i get 20 customers the patriots are playing the jets.i give 10 guys the patriots and 10 guys the jets this way the 10 guys who had the winner will call back while the 10 suckers who bet the jets will just go away and you replace them with 10 new suckers.this is what all touts do.
